MEMO — Launch Plan: Orvath Pulse

To: Sales Leads

Orvath Pulse launches first Monday of next quarter. Pilot regions: Delmere and Castrow. Pricing locked; no discounting above 8% without sign-off from Rhea Tollan. Collateral ships Friday. Demo units limited — one per territory until week three. Channel partners get briefed after direct teams, not before. Target: 40 qualified opportunities per region in the first month. Escalate supply issues to Ops, not to me. Keep the next item strictly within this distribution list.

internal memo for kaduf-baduf: Only 35 of the 378 pilot accounts renewed Holir, so a churn review is set for June 11. Eliielax Group is in early talks to buy Silaelix Group for about $142.1 million.

Reviewers of the Wrenpost parcel-tracking webhook should understand the retry contract before approving changes. Deliveries are at-least-once: receivers must dedupe on event sequence numbers, and any change to the payload envelope requires a consumer sign-off from the Ferngate integrations team. Signature verification happens in middleware, so handlers must never assume raw bodies are trusted. Backoff intervals are configured centrally, not per-endpoint. The full webhook design notes and schema history are on the internal page here.

wiki page, kajef-fahop: https://confluence.qorvelworks.corp/view/projects/pages/20cd971ffb91

## Environments: Payquarry Integration Tests

Payquarry's integration suite runs against three environments: dev, shadow, and cert. Flakes cluster in shadow because it shares a ledger database with nightly reconciliation jobs. Reviewers: a red shadow run alone does not block a merge; rerun once, then check the reconciliation schedule. Cert failures always block. Quarantined tests live in a separate tag. Shadow currently runs with the configuration below.

service settings:
[casax]
port = 6379
team = rusir
host = casax.zemvarhq.corp
region = outer-4
access_code = ac_9808ce
timeout_ms = 1500